Stephen Leigh
Steve Leigh is an American science fiction writer, bass guitarist and singer.
Steve Leigh lives in Cincinnati, Ohio. He has won the Spectrum Award, been on the Locus Top 10 First Novel, Recommended Books and Best Seller lists, and been nominated for the Tiptree Award.
Works
- Slow Fall to Dawn (October 1981)
- Dance of the Hag (March 1983)
- A Quiet of Stone (February 1984)
- The Bones of God (November 1986)
- The Crystal Memory (September 1987)
- The Secret of the Lona (Dr. Bones #1) (September 1988)
- Changling: Robots & Aliens #1 (August, 1989)
- The Abraxas Marvel Circus (May 1990)
- Alien Tongue (August 1991)
- Dinosaur World (May 1992)
- Dinosaur Planet (February 1993)
- Dinosaur Samurai (w/ John J. Miller) (November 1993)
- Dinosaur Warriors (June 1994)
- Dinosaur Empire (with John J. Miller) (March 1995)
- Dinosaur Conquest (October 1995)
- Dark Water's Embrace (March 1998)
- Speaking Stones (March 1999)
